Content of Carnosine in Chicken Breast Muscles
Carnosine is a dipeptide concentrated in poultry muscle tissue. Its beneficial effects have been recently recognized. Carnosine has been proven to have anti-ageing effects. Meat enriched with carnosine can be considered as functional food. The research aim was to identify concentration of carnosine in chicken breast muscle with respect to chicken sex. The research confirmed that chicken white meat was richer in carnosine than other chicken meat parts. Reffering to chicken sex, differences in carnosine concentrations were also determined. Carnosine concentrations were determined by means of high performance liquid chromatography (HPLC). Muscle tissue of female chickens contained 971.4±119.2 μg/g of carnosine, while male muscle tissue had 932.80±106.90 μg/g of carnosine. Indicators of technological meat quality (pH, WHC and meat colour) were also assessed on the same samples. The obtained research results were analyzed in the context of other relevant studies.
